1. MECE Classification of Amazon Sale Structure
To understand Amazon sales, it is necessary to first organize its "hierarchy". Broadly speaking, it can be classified into the following 3 categories.
- Big Sales (Several times a year): Largest scale events covering all categories, such as Prime Day and Black Friday.
- Time Sale Festival (Monthly): Medium scale sale held for several days. Point up campaign is attached.
- Permanent/Special Sales: Daily special time sales, inventory clearance sales, etc.
Especially during big sale periods, discount rates for Amazon devices and large appliances are maximized , and recognition as "the cheapest time" is established for consumers.
2. Annual Schedule and Identification of "Cheapest Time"
Overviewing Amazon's annual calendar, points where GMV (Gross Merchandise Value) surges in specific months become visible.
As is clear from the graph, the time when prices drop the most in the year and the real price including point return becomes "the cheapest time" is July's "Prime Day" and November's "Black Friday". In these 2 major sales, Amazon itself secures a large amount of inventory and induces strong traffic, so vendors and sellers also increase price competitiveness.
3. Inventory & Price Strategy EC Managers Should be Conscious of During Sale
Not just "buying at cheap times", but the perspective of "how to sell at cheap times" is essential for EC operation side. It is important to understand Amazon's dynamic pricing mechanism and analyze competitor trends with tools like Keepa.
Especially when using FBA (Fulfillment by Amazon), strict adherence to delivery deadlines before sales and optimization of inventory turnover (DOH: Days On Hand) after sales are directly connected to maximization of cash flow.
FAQ
- Q. Prime Day vs Black Friday, which is cheaper?
- A. Depending on the category, Amazon devices and PC related items tend to have the lowest price on Prime Day, while daily necessities, fashion, and gift demand items tend to have the lowest price on Black Friday.
- Q. Should I wait for the Time Sale Festival?
- A. If not in a hurry, waiting for the Time Sale Festival held every month improves the point return rate by a few percent, so it is possible to suppress the real price.
